Recently I have been working a lot on how I frame thoughts in my mind so that they are beneficial instead of something that pulls me down. Already, I am seeing a difference in my thinking and mood. Even with everything going on, I am trying my best to stay optimistic and recognize when I am thinking negatively and unrealistically. The two main concepts I have been working on are "all-or-nothing thinking" and "over generalization". These are also known as cognitive distortions meaning that your negative mindset is changing how you view things.


Recognizing when these occur have helped me so I am not thinking in "black and white". Instead, I try to find somewhere in the middle between "bad" and "good" or "never" and "always". Even just noticing when these thoughts occur helps me realize how greatly it impacts how I see myself, others, and different situations in life.
